actor submissions
actors and representatives may submit professional materials to oilibhear for casting consideration.
we use this information to identify and consider performers for current and future projects, maintain casting records and communicate with actors and representatives where relevant.
submission does not guarantee consideration for, or communication regarding, a particular project.
where information is retained for future casting consideration, it will be kept only for as long as it remains reasonably relevant and useful for that purpose and will be reviewed periodically.

sensitive information
casting information may sometimes include personal characteristics relevant to a role or production.
where you voluntarily provide information that is considered sensitive or special category personal data under data protection law, we will only use it where there is an appropriate legal basis for doing so.
we will not ask for sensitive information where it is not relevant or necessary.

our legal basis for using information
depending on the circumstances, we process personal information because:
it is necessary for our legitimate interests in operating a casting office and carrying out casting work
it is necessary to take steps at your request before entering into an agreement or to perform an agreement
you have given your consent, including where appropriate for marketing communications or certain sensitive information
we are required to do so by law
where processing is based on consent, you may withdraw that consent at any time.
